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Black Truffle | Goodman’s Mouse Lemur |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(Fungi)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Ascomycota (Sac Fungi)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Pezizomycetes (Pezizomycetes)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Pezizales (Pezizales)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Tuberaceae | Cheirogaleidae |
| Genus | Tuber | Microcebus |
| Species | Tuber melanosporum | Microcebus lehilahytsara |
